The City of New Smyrna Beach, located in Volusia County, Florida, has issued solicitation 24-26-FIN for a Tax-Exempt Capital Improvement Refunding Revenue Note. This procurement process is managed by the Purchasing department, with Janet Vivian serving as the primary point of contact. The solicitation was posted on September 2, 2026, and requires responses to be submitted by September 21, 2026, at 6:00 PM. All participants must adhere to Florida Statutes Chapter 119 regarding public records, acknowledging that submitted materials become city property and are subject to public review. The contractor is responsible for maintaining and transferring public records in compatible electronic formats and must follow specific protocols for handling confidential or exempt information. The City operates on a fiscal year from October 1st to September 30th, and further financial context is available through its Annual Comprehensive Financial Reports and adopted budget books.

The City serves an area of 41.6 square miles in size and serves a population of approximately 33,402. It is located off of Florida's East Coast, in the County of Volusia, just north of Cape Canaveral with easy access to both Interstate 95 and Interstate 4. The City's fiscal year begins on October 1st and ends on September 30th. Information on the City's government and financial information can be found in City of New Smyrna's Annual Comprehensive Financial Reports (ACFR) and the annual adopted budget. The San Francisco International Airport is conducting Request for Qualifications RFQ 50433 to establish a prequalified pool of financial institutions to support the Airport Commission's financing needs. The scope of work involves identifying Providers capable of offering credit, liquidity, or alternative credit facilities to support variable rate bonds and commercial paper notes, as well as making direct purchases of bonds and notes. Inclusion in the pool does not guarantee a contract but allows the Commission to solicit further proposals and negotiate terms on an as-needed basis. The prequalified pool is valid for two years, with a possible extension for an additional two years, while resulting contracts may have terms up to ten years. To qualify for the pool, applicants must pass a binary evaluation based on two mandatory minimum qualifications regarding credit ratings from at least two nationally recognized agencies. Long-term ratings must be at least A2 for Moody's, A for S&P, or A for Fitch, and short-term ratings must be at least P-1 for Moody's, A-1 for S&P, or F1 for Fitch. Selected Providers must also undergo a cybersecurity risk assessment, which may include a SOC-2 Type 2 report, and comply with the City's Mandatory Green Purchasing Requirements and the Health Care Accountability Ordinance. The final deadline for submissions is May 31, 2028, and all selected providers and facilities remain subject to Commission approval.

Walton County is soliciting quotes for solicitation number 13-26 to perform cleaning, repair, and repainting services for the existing East and West entrance monument signs at the Northwest Florida Commerce Park, also known as Mossy Head Industrial Park, located along State Road 285 in Walton County, Florida. The project involves poured-concrete and grouted CMU monument walls with a smooth stucco finish situated within raised planter areas. The scope of work includes pressure washing to remove dirt and biological growth, repairing damaged or deteriorated stucco and concrete surfaces, removing old signage hardware, and applying a two-coat 100% acrylic elastomeric masonry coating, specifically Sherwin-Williams Loxon XP or an approved equal. This solicitation is distinct from a companion project involving the fabrication and installation of new logo elements and dimensional lettering. Contractors are required to field-verify all existing site conditions and dimensions prior to performing work and must submit pre-repair inspection photos to the County. The project must comply with local codes and NFPA requirements, ensuring that all repairs, such as planter coping, match the existing profiles and aesthetic finishes. Proposals must be submitted electronically through the OpenGov Procurement portal no later than September 14, 2026, at 2:00 PM. While the solicitation does not specify a contract value or a formal period of performance, it requires the completion of a vendor questionnaire, and new vendors must provide a W-9 and ACH form upon award.
